AI's Diagnostic Powerhouse & The Doctor's Art: Navigating Healthcare's Future
The landscape of modern medicine is undergoing a profound transformation, largely driven by the remarkable advancements in Artificial Intelligence. AI algorithms are demonstrating an extraordinary aptitude for diagnosing health issues, often with a speed and precision that rivals, and in some cases, even surpasses human capabilities. From analyzing complex medical images like X-rays, MRIs, and CT scans to identifying subtle anomalies indicative of diseases such as cancer or neurological disorders, AI is proving to be an invaluable tool in the early detection and classification of conditions. Its ability to process vast datasets of patient information, genetic markers, and research findings allows it to spot intricate patterns and predict disease risks with impressive accuracy.
This diagnostic prowess extends across various medical fields. In radiology, AI can flag suspicious lesions, reducing the burden on human radiologists and potentially minimizing diagnostic errors. In pathology, it can quickly analyze tissue samples for signs of malignancy. Even in ophthalmology, AI models can detect early signs of diabetic retinopathy or glaucoma. These capabilities are not merely incremental improvements; they represent a paradigm shift, promising earlier interventions and potentially life-saving diagnoses for countless patients globally.
However, while AI excels at identifying "what" is wrong, the intricate art of deciding "how" to make it right remains firmly in the realm of human expertise. Doctors are still unequivocally superior when it comes to weighing treatment options. This distinction is crucial, as treatment planning involves far more than just matching a diagnosis to a standard protocol. It requires a holistic understanding of the patient as an individual, encompassing their unique medical history, comorbidities, lifestyle, personal values, socioeconomic factors, and emotional state.
A human physician brings empathy, ethical reasoning, and the ability to adapt to unforeseen circumstances—qualities that AI currently lacks. They can engage in nuanced conversations about a patient's fears and hopes, assess their tolerance for risk, and tailor a treatment plan that aligns with their desired quality of life. Deciding between aggressive therapies with severe side effects versus more conservative approaches, considering a patient's mental resilience for a demanding recovery, or navigating complex end-of-life care discussions all demand a human touch that extends far beyond algorithmic decision-making.
The future of healthcare, therefore, is not one of replacement but of powerful collaboration. AI will serve as an indispensable diagnostic assistant, providing doctors with enhanced insights and freeing them to focus on what they do best: applying their clinical judgment, experience, and compassion to guide patients through complex treatment pathways. This synergy promises to elevate the standard of care, making healthcare more efficient, accurate, and profoundly personalized.
